Program Outcomes 

This Black Belt program builds upon the lessons taught in Lean Six Sigma Green Belt training and teaches you how to situationally apply Lean Six Sigma tools and techniques for the projects you lead and support.

At the conclusion of this eight-week program, you should expect to be able to:

  • Manage a portfolio of Lean Six Sigma projects consistent with organizational needs
  • Execute a Lean Six Sigma Black Belt project through the five phases of DMAIC
  • Apply appropriate mentoring and coaching methods to assist Lean Six Sigma Green Belts in their projects
  • Assess and apply appropriate Lean Six Sigma tools during the execution of a Black Belt project
  • Employ software programs (Minitab and/or MS Excel) to validate data and identify potential solutions

Who should enroll?

This program covers the advanced tools and approaches a Lean Six Sigma Green Belt needs to learn to take their process improvement skills to the next level.
Lean Six Sigma Black Belts are typically professionals who possess or aspire to higher-level leadership and management positions. Leading process improvement projects, Lean Six Sigma Black Belts guide teams and mentor Lean Six Sigma Green Belts.

The advanced Lean Six Sigma concepts taught in this program are applicable across virtually any industry, including manufacturing, healthcare, government, technology, aerospace, pharmaceuticals, engineering and business.

Program Content Summary

Week 1: Introduction to Lean Six Sigma

  • Lean Principles and Concepts
  • Principles of the Toyota Way
  • Advanced Six Sigma Tools and Concepts
  • Design for Six Sigma
  • Lean vs. DMAIC

Week 2: Project Assessment and Planning

  • Project Selection and Valuation
  • Hoshin Planning and KPIs
  • Project and Portfolio Tracking and Reporting
  • Project Management Tools

Week 3: Roles, Team Dynamics and Change Management

  • Effective Lean Six Sigma Teams
  • Coaching and Mentoring
  • Organizational Culture and Change Management
  • Stakeholder Management

Week 4: Define and Measure Phases

  • Voice of the Customer
  • Voice of the Employee
  • Voice of the Business
  • Voice of the Process
  • Process Variation
  • Advanced Statistical Process Control
  • Advanced MSA and Metrology
  • Running Process Capability Studies

Week 5: Analyze Phase

  • Advanced Analysis Tools
  • Analysis of Variance (ANOVA)
  • Advanced Regression Analysis
  • Design of Experiments

Week 6: Improve Phase

  • Generating and Evaluating Solutions
  • Planning and Supporting Solution Deployment
  • Visual Management
  • Creating the Future State

Week 7: Control Phase

  • Statistical Process Control
  • Standardization and Replication
  • Sustaining Improvements
  • The Control System

Week 8: Pulling it all Together

  • Project Closure
  • PDCA
  • Project Documentation
  • Problem Solving Approaches
